Moore Threads has released and open‑sourced MusaCoder, a code‑focused large language model optimized for GPU‑level operator generation. It is the first open‑source code LLM trained and validated end‑to‑end on a domestic full‑stack GPU compute base; all post‑training was completed on the Kua'e intelligent compute cluster built on MTTS 5000. In KernelBench's strict evaluation, MusaCoder‑27B‑RL recorded OverallPass@893.2% and Avg.@888.60%, outperforming Claude OPUS 4.7, DeepSeek‑V4 Pro, GLM‑5.1 and Kimi K2.6 and reaching industry‑leading performance.
